Proposed Development
Section 254 Licence for 4 no finger post signs as follows. Sign 1, Located at Butlerstown Roundabout on the corner of Cork Road and R710. Sign 2. Located at Six Cross Roads Roundabout at the corner of R710 and Kilbarry Exit. Sign 3 Located at Six Cross Roads Business Park Roundabout at the corner of new Ormonde Housing Development. Sign no 4 Located at Ballindud Roundabout at the corner of R710 and the R675
